Abstract

The utility model discloses a portable medical air pressurization soft oxygen tank, which comprises a soft tank body (1) and an oxygen intake connecter (11), wherein, an inlet in the upper part of the soft tank body (1) is sealed with a two side zipper (15), and an air intake connecter (10) is communicated with an air filtering compressing cleaning device (8) formed by a butterfly compressor filtered by double end air and an efficient air cleaning filters through a medical flexible pipe (9). An excess pressure relief valve (3) is arranged on the soft tank body (1). The utility model can meet the needs of gas quality for treatment, which eliminates fully insecure factors. Moreover, the utility model can be folded with a light weight and a easy carrying.

Description

Portable medical air pressurized software oxygen cabin
Technical field
This utility model relates to a kind of armarium, relates in particular to a kind of portable oxygen cabin.
Background technology
Known portable medical hyperbaric oxygen chamber, its structure is normally made the cabin body that can inflate with pressurized by high-intensity aluminium alloy or plastics, but the cabin body can not fold, weight is heavier, carry inconvenience, the gas that charges in the cabin is oxygen, and pressure reaches 3ATA, carries out hyperbaric oxygentherapy under above-mentioned pressure.But, charge into the CO that the oxygen in the cabin is breathed out when treatment 2Pollute with other waste gas, can not be replaced by pure and fresh gas again, GAS QUALITY does not satisfy the treatment requirement in the cabin, thereby its therapeutic effect is bad; The high pressure oxygen of high concentration in the cabin exists to cause the fire unsafe factor simultaneously.
Summary of the invention
The purpose of this utility model is to overcome above-mentioned shortcoming and a kind of energy of providing satisfies treatment desired gas quality requirements, eliminates unsafe factor fully, and is collapsible, in light weight, the portable medical air pressurized software oxygen cabin that is easy to carry about with one.
The technical scheme that this utility model technical solution problem is adopted is:
Portable medical air pressurized software oxygen cabin, comprise soft cabin body, advance the oxygen joint, main observation window on the body of soft cabin and side observation window, wherein: body upper inlet place, soft cabin seals with double-sided slide fastener, inlet suction port is communicated with the air filtration compression cleaning device of being made up of double end airfiltering butterfly chip compressor and highly effective air cleaning and filtering by flexible pipe for medical purpose, and soft cabin body is provided with the overbottom pressure relief valve.Body inside, soft cabin is provided with dismountable dimension shape support, and dimension shape support and soft cabin body inwall are fitted, and each corresponding placement of two ends is two in the body of cabin, after keeping cabin body venting definite shape is arranged, and is convenient to personnel and advances cabin and deliver from vault.Body bottom, soft cabin is provided with external pad in cabin and delta-ring, and soft cabin body places on the external pad in cabin, and two delta-rings place the external pad contact surface of soft cabin body and cabin both sides respectively, move to prevent soft cabin body.
Soft cabin body is provided with Pressure gauge, two-sided decompression exhaust valve.
This utility model compared with prior art, by above technical scheme as can be known, the air filtration compression cleaning device that adopts double end air filtration compressor and efficient online air filtering system (filtration reaches 0.01 micron) to form charges into the cleaning forced air in soft cabin body (circular, oval or square), after reaching operating pressure, utilize the overbottom pressure control valve to discharge waste gas in the cabin, constantly charge into simultaneously pure and fresh forced air, keep the dynamic equilibrium of operating pressure in the cabin, guarantee to have good GAS QUALITY in the cabin.Owing to use air pressurized, oxygen concentration maintains in the safety range in the cabin, the unsafe factor of having avoided high-concentration oxygen to cause, all openable dual face seals is marched inside and outside two-sided decompression exhaust valve, overbottom pressure relief valve, Pressure gauge and the cabin of installing on the body of soft cabin, guarantee that the cabin internal pressure is no more than the operating pressure of regulation, use fool proof.Soft cabin body adopts the polyester material monolithic to be shaped, the specific strength height, and collapsible, weight is no more than 20 kilograms, is contained in the Soft Roll that braces arranged, and the individual carries very convenient.Therefore, this utility model can guarantee to have good GAS QUALITY in the cabin, improves curative effect.Eliminated the factor that causes fire simultaneously, used fool proofly, easy to operate, in 15 minutes, can finish inflation, test and the treatment in cabin and prepare.The treatment of diseases scope, except the suitable disease of hyperbaric oxygentherapy, owing to can adopt little high pressure, hypoxia (28%~40% oxygen concentration) to treat, damage, the damage of human body, the damage of tendon, surgical incision to brain have better curative effect, be a significant benefit to the improvement of inflammation and viscera disease, autism of children there is special curative effect, is specially adapted to FAMB, clinic, rehabilitation center and individual and uses.

The specific embodiment
Below in conjunction with accompanying drawing and preferred embodiment, to the specific embodiment, structure, feature and effect thereof according to the portable medical air pressurized software oxygen cabin that the utility model proposes, describe in detail as after.
Referring to accompanying drawing: portable medical air pressurized software oxygen cabin, comprise soft cabin body 1, advance oxygen joint 11, main observation window 12 on the soft cabin body 1 and side observation window 7, wherein: body 1 upper inlet place in soft cabin seals with double-sided slide fastener 15, inlet suction port 10 is communicated with the air filtration compression cleaning device of being made up of double end airfiltering butterfly chip compressor and highly effective air cleaning and filtering 8 by flexible pipe for medical purpose 9, and soft cabin body 1 is provided with overbottom pressure relief valve 3.
Soft cabin body 1 is provided with Pressure gauge 13, two-sided decompression exhaust valve 14.
Body 1 inside, soft cabin is provided with dismountable dimension shape support 2, and dimension shape support 2 is fitted with soft cabin body 1 inwall, and each correspondence of two ends is placed two in the body of cabin, after keeping cabin body venting definite shape is arranged, and is convenient to personnel and advances cabin and deliver from vault.
Body bottom, soft cabin is provided with external pad 5 in cabin and delta-ring 6, and soft cabin body 1 places on the external pad 5 in cabin, and two delta-rings 6 place soft cabin body 1 and external pad 5 contact surface both sides, cabin respectively, move to prevent soft cabin body 1.
During use, enter soft cabin body 1 after drawing back soft cabin body 1 top double-sided slide fastener 15, lie on the medical bed mattress 4, face orientation master observation window 12, drawn double-sided slide fastener 15 then from the inside, clean, fresh air process flexible pipe for medical purpose 9 inlet suction ports 10 by 8 processing of air filtration compression cleaning device, in the cabin, inflate, when the cabin internal gas pressure reaches operating pressure, overbottom pressure relief valve 3 begins to discharge the fresh air that waste gas cleans simultaneously in the cabin and constantly charges into, it is equal with release tolerance to charge into tolerance, keeps gas-dynamic balance in the cabin.Oxygen enters by advancing oxygen joint 11, can form oxygen concentration and is 28%~40% mixture of oxygen or configuration oxygen absorption mask and inhale medical pure oxygen, when treatment finishes, draws back double-deck slide fastener 15 or the two-sided decompression exhaust valve 14 of outwarding winding is decompressed to atmospheric pressure, and the people gets final product deliver from vault.After making decompression, keep soft cabin body definite shape; dismountable dimension shape support 2 of the inner placement of cabin body for protecting soft cabin body and preventing that it from moving, is placed external pad 5 in cabin and delta-ring 6 in soft cabin body bottom; for ease of the astrodome internal pressure, soft cabin body is provided with Pressure gauge 13.
